Warning Signs You Need Contents Restoration Services

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ore the warning signs of water damage, call our team today to schedule an appointment.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a musty smell in your home that won’t go away, it’s likely a sign of hidden water damage. Our team can help you identify and extract the source of the smell, restoring your home to a fresh and clean state.

Warped or Discolored Wood

If you notice warped or discolored wood in your home, it’s likely a sign of water damage. Our team can help you restore your wood surfaces to their pre-loss condition, using specialized equipment and techniques to prevent further damage.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

If you notice peeling paint or wallpaper in your home, it’s likely a sign of water damage. Our team can help you restore your walls to their pre-loss condition, using specialized equipment and techniques to prevent further damage.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

If you notice water stains on your ceilings or walls, it’s likely a sign of water damage. Our team can help you identify and extract the source of the stain, restoring your home to a dry and clean state.

Unpleasant Odors from Your HVAC System

If you notice unpleasant odors coming from your HVAC system, it’s likely a sign of hidden water damage. Our team can help you identify and extract the source of the odor, restoring your home to a fresh and clean state.

Water Damage from a Leaky Roof

If you notice water damage from a leaky roof, it’s likely a sign of a more serious issue. Our team can help you identify and repair the source of the leak, restoring your home to a dry and secure state.

Contents Restoration Services Cost in Eastman, GA

The cost of contents restoration services can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Eastman, GA. Our team will provide a free estimate for your specific situation, outlining the work that needs to be done and the costs involved.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and number of equipment units needed
Content restoration $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area and type of contents damaged
Final inspection and cleanup $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and complexity of restoration
Moisture-reading equipment rental $200 – $1,000 Number of equipment units needed and rental duration
Desiccant dehumidifier rental $500 – $2,500 Number of equipment units needed and rental duration

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and a detailed estimate will be provided for your specific situation.
